/** A pool of server sessions.
This is a continuation so that it can get callbacks from the server sessions.
This is used to track remote closes on the sessions so they can be cleaned up.
@internal Cleanup is the real reason we will always need an IP address mapping for the
sessions. The I/O callback will have only the NetVC and thence the remote IP address for the
closed session and we need to be able find it based on that.
*/
class ServerSessionPool : public Continuation
{
public:
/// Default constructor.
/// Constructs an empty pool.
ServerSessionPool();
/// Handle events from server sessions.
int eventHandler(int event, void *data);
static bool validate_host_sni(HttpSM *sm, NetVConnection *netvc);
static bool validate_sni(HttpSM *sm, NetVConnection *netvc);
static bool validate_cert(HttpSM *sm, NetVConnection *netvc);
int
count() const
{
return m_ip_pool.count();
}
private:
void removeSession(PoolableSession *ssn);
void addSession(PoolableSession *ssn);
using IPTable = IntrusiveHashMap<PoolableSession::IPLinkage>;
using FQDNTable = IntrusiveHashMap<PoolableSession::FQDNLinkage>;
public:
/** Check if a session matches address and host name.
*/
static bool match(PoolableSession *ss, sockaddr const *addr, CryptoHash const &host_hash,
TSServerSessionSharingMatchMask match_style);
/** Get a session from the pool.
The session is selected based on @a match_style equivalently to @a match. If found the session
is removed from the pool.
@return A pointer to the session or @c NULL if not matching session was found.
*/
HSMresult_t acquireSession(sockaddr const *addr, CryptoHash const &host_hash, TSServerSessionSharingMatchMask match_style,
HttpSM *sm, PoolableSession *&server_session);
/** Release a session to the pool.
*/
void releaseSession(PoolableSession *ss);
/// Close all sessions and then clear the table.
void purge();
// Pools of server sessions.
// Note that each server session is stored in both pools.
IPTable m_ip_pool;
FQDNTable m_fqdn_pool;
};
